What is the primary function of the axon in a neuron?
A
To synthesize neurotransmitters
B
To receive incoming signals from other neurons
C
To provide structural support to the neuron
D
To transmit electrical impulses away from the cell body toward other neurons or effectors
Verified step by step guidance
1
Step 1: Understand the structure of a neuron. A neuron consists of three main parts: the cell body (soma), dendrites, and axon. Each part has a specific function.
Step 2: Learn the role of the axon. The axon is a long, slender projection of the neuron that is specialized for transmitting electrical impulses (action potentials) away from the cell body.
Step 3: Compare the axon's function to the other options provided. For example, neurotransmitter synthesis occurs in the cell body, not the axon. Receiving signals is the function of dendrites, and structural support is provided by the cytoskeleton, not the axon.
Step 4: Recognize that the axon's primary function is to transmit electrical impulses to other neurons, muscles, or glands, enabling communication within the nervous system.
Step 5: Conclude that the correct answer is: 'To transmit electrical impulses away from the cell body toward other neurons or effectors,' based on the axon's specialized role in neural communication.
